Oldsmobile 394ci 10.25:1 Specs
Oldsmobile Oldsmobile 394ci · 4.124" × 3.688" · 10.25:1 engine specs: 394 ci (6.5L), 8-cylinder, 4.124" bore x 3.688" stroke, 10.25:1 compression.
Dimensions
| Displacement | 394 ci / 6.5 L |
|---|
| Bore | 4.124" |
|---|
| Stroke | 3.688" |
|---|
| Cylinders | 8 |
|---|
| Compression ratio | 10.25:1 |
|---|
| Rod length | 7" |
|---|
| Rod ratio | 1.898 |
|---|
| Bore/stroke ratio | 1.118 |
|---|
Construction
| Induction | 1-4 |
|---|
| Advertised HP | 280 hp |
|---|
| Years | 1964 |
|---|
What these numbers mean
| Bore/stroke character | 1.118 — oversquare — bore exceeds stroke, which favours higher RPM and larger valves |
|---|
| Mean piston speed at 6,000 RPM | 3,688 ft/min — in the range typical of performance street engines |
|---|
| Rod ratio | 1.898 — long — less side loading on the cylinder wall, favours high RPM |
|---|
| Displacement per cylinder | 49.3 ci |
|---|
| Static compression | 10.25:1 — in the range that usually runs on pump premium |
|---|
Cylinder head
| Chamber volume | 70.9 cc |
|---|
| Rocker ratio | 1.8:1 |
|---|
| Lifter type | hydraulic |
|---|
